Income
Money earned from working or providing services.
Wages
Money paid based on hours worked.
Salary
A fixed amount of money earned each year.
Education
Learning and schooling that builds knowledge.
Skills
Abilities a person has to do tasks well.
Experience
Knowledge gained by doing a job over time.
Occupation
A job or type of work a person does.
Career
A long-term path of related jobs.
Human capital
Skills, education, and experience that make workers valuable.
Productivity
How much work is done in a certain time.
Specialization
Focusing on one specific skill or task.
Job market
Where workers and employers connect.
Demand for labor
How many workers employers want to hire.
Supply of labor
How many workers are available.
Incentive
A reward that motivates people to act.
Entrepreneurship
Starting and running a business.
Technology
Tools that help people work more efficiently.
Economic conditions
The overall state of the economy.
Discrimination
Unfair treatment based on personal traits.
Labor union
A group that represents workers.
Benefits
Extra compensation like health insurance.
Taxes
Money paid to the government.
Cost of living
How expensive it is to live in a place.
Standard of living
Quality of life based on income and costs.
Investment in self
Time or money spent improving skills.
